Breaking News-RTRS - Malaysian palm oil output to fall after July peak-MPOB

KUALA LUMPUR, Aug 8 (Reuters) - Malaysia's palm oil production hit its highest for this year in July and will start a downward trend expected to last until December, a top official of industry regulator Malaysian Palm Oil Board (MPOB) said on Monday.
Palm oil production in the world's No.2 supplier of the vegetable oil has climbed steadily on favourable crop weather and a recovery in yields that has weighed on benchmark futures.
MPOB Director General Choo Yuen May said the trend will reverse after the July peak as foreign labourers go on extended leave for Eid al-Fitr holidays, leaving more palm fruits unharvested.
